What is business analytics ?
Business analytics is comprised of solutions used to build analysis models and simulations to create scenarios, understand realities and predict future states.
What happened in the past ?
DESCRIPTIVE
- Statistical method used to search and summarize historical data in order to identify patterns or meaning.
- To produce the key performance indicators (KPIs) and metrics.
Why did it happen ?
DIAGNOSTIC
- Helps identify anomalies and determine casual relationships in data with data mining, drill-down, data discovery and correlations.
What will happen in the future ?
PREDICTIVE
- Classification, clustering, forecasting and outliers, time series models.
How can we make it happen ?
PRESCRIPTIVE
- Stochastic optimization to a modeling approach of the random probability distribution that explores several possible actions suggesting actions based on the results of descriptive and predictive analytics of a given dataset.
